The track is only about 40 minutes from my house, we ride there regularly. I know the track owner and his son, they do a good job with the area they available. I have rented the track a few times for private ride days, you can have up to 12 riders for a private track day so I grab 11 buddies and we split the cost. Ride all the laps you can handle, its pretty cool.
